Cienfuegos - Castillo de Jagua

The Castillo de Jagua is located just outside of Cienfuegos. This castle, built by Jose Tantete, stands at the entrance to the Bay, Bahia de Cienfuegos and can be reached either by road heading west from Cienfuegos, or by taking a short ferry ride from the east shore across the mouth of the Bay to the west shore. The Citadel was designed to be a safeguard against pirates in the first half of the 18th Century.

Entrance to the Castillo de Jagua is by a drawbridge over a moat, which is now dry. In the fortress courtyard is an old prison and chapel. There is a legend about the castle being haunted by a woman wearing blue who would taunt and terrorize the guards.

The Castillo de Jagua has been turned into a restaurant and lounge.
